当前位置:主页 > 云存储 > 安全 >

企业网站_个人域名不备案可以吗_高性能

  • 安全
  • 2021-07-13 10:50
  • 动埠云

这是我关于SAP云平台上云架构的博客系列的第7部分。您可以在这里找到概述页面。

架构师应该能够重用由他或她自己或其他人创建的模式和最佳实践,他们已经创造了他们的经验并分享了它们。这种知识体系可以称为体系结构存储库或体系结构库。这些常见模式有助于建立标准化并大大缩短生产时间,因为架构师可以依赖这些最佳实践,而无需在找到工作解决方案之前对几种方法进行事先评估。

我相信SAP CP项目的初学者和专业人员都可以从这些指导中获益,并能够验证他们自己的体系结构与建议的体系结构对比。

作为实际的SAP CP项目的架构师,您可能会获得越来越多的经验,因此我鼓励您开始创建自己的体系结构库,并与其他人共享。由于以身作则是一种很好的做法,因此我将与大家分享我的第一个版本的SAP CP体系结构(仅在SAP CP的Neo环境中测试),这是我过去曾使用过的,也是我经常推荐的。我会从非常琐碎的事情开始,然后逐渐增加复杂性,这样每个人都可以轻松消费。

但要小心:所有的建议都是我个人的建议,而不是SAP的"官方参考"。在某些情况下,场景可能不适用于您的显式项目,可能是因为您公司的数据安全原因或缺少某些组件。尽管如此,我还是尽可能仔细地创建了架构集合,这意味着我对作为架构师支持的项目中的所有场景都有实践经验。你不会发现我的任何建议,我只知道"口碑推荐","阅读手册",或我不会推荐给我自己的客户。对于官方参考体系结构,请考虑查看我的开发团队同事目前发布的蓝图:https://www.sap.com/developer/blueprints.html

我认为如果我们都能开始分享我们的情景并进行讨论,那就太好了。希望我的建议能对您的项目有所帮助,无论您是刚刚起步,必须了解SAP Cloud Connector,还是您是先进的,必须处理主要传播、联合身份提供商和混合应用程序环境。

我将在本博客中介绍以下体系结构:

因此让我们从单独的描述开始:

1)通过SAP Cloud Connector进行Cloud-2内部集成

好的,这是为初学者准备的:如果您想向SAP CP中的应用程序公开资源,您应该使用SAP Cloud Connector(SCC)。SCC安装在您的本地网络中,并与您的后端系统具有直接的网络连接。然后将SCC配置为打开到您的全局帐户的单个子帐户的隧道(在我的博客系列中解释差异)https://blogs.sap.com/2016/10/21/part-1-understanding-hcp-global-accounts-sub-accounts-concept-means-corporate-hcp-architecture/). 然后在SCC配置中添加要公开的资源(可以公开HTTP、RFC,因为SCC2.10.0.1还可以公开到云的TCP连接)。然后,网购返利,子帐户中的应用程序使用目的地(在子帐户中配置)访问后端系统(您也可以配置指向公共internet中资源的目的地,在这种情况下,您不需要SCC)。注意:在您的环境中,访问SCC是最关键的。严格控制它,因为SCC是将资源暴露给外部世界的组件。当然,一个SCC可以将多个后端暴露到您的云上。

2)通过SCC进行cloud-2内部集成,什么是物联网技术,使用子账户和单个SCC完成分离

如果您有多个不相关的项目,您应该将它们分为不同的子帐户(参见。https://blogs.sap.com/2016/10/21/part-1-understanding-hcp-global-accounts-sub-accounts-concept-means-corporate-hcp-architecture/). 不过,您可以与多个子帐户和多个后端共享一个sapcloudconnector,而不会相互影响。在SCC中,几乎所有的配置都是按子帐户维护的。我试着用下图中的颜色来表示这一点。后端A仅对承载应用程序A的子帐户公开,而后端B仅对单独子帐户中的应用程序B和C可用。所以你不需要每个项目都有单独的scc。因为SCC要安装在不同的机器上(不要将它们安装在现有后端系统之上!),否则,一旦您的云增长,这将增加本地计算机的数量。顺便说一句:即使在敏捷的DevOps环境中,我也不会让项目A和B的开发人员配置那些中央scc!SCC应由关注所有项目的第三方(如您的IT管理员)进行配置,并确保它们不会影响不属于它们的子帐户的配置。

3)通过服务渠道和SCC进行本地2云集成

为了访问位于SAP CP中的HANA数据库,您应该同时使用SCC。在SCC中,您可以从子帐户配置一个到单个数据库的"服务通道"。然后,SCC在其内部网络接口上打开一个端口。您可以使用JDBC/ODBC客户机从内部网络(例如后端系统)连接到此端口并访问数据库。我在以下场景中使用了这种集成:

猜你喜欢

微信公众号